Batman: Dark Tomorrow goes multiplatform
The Batman game formerly in development exclusively for the GameCube will now appear on multiple systems.
GameSpot has learned that Batman: Dark Tomorrow, which was thought to be in development exclusively for the GameCube, is now in development for the Xbox and PlayStation 2 as well. Unfortunately, there aren't many details available on the game other than it will have an original storyline created by DC Comics. It will also feature some of the classic Batman villains such as Killer Croc and Poison Ivy.
We'll have more on Dark Tomorrow as it becomes available. Batman: Dark Tomorrow is tentatively scheduled for release in Q4 2002.
